I would use IPCop which is based on Smoothwall http://www.ipcop.org It is a dedicated Linux based firewall solution, with support for DHCP, NAT (port forwarding), a DNZ, Web Proxy via Squid and intrusion detection, just to name a few of the features. Just download the ISO, burn to CD, boot on the system that is to be the firewall box and follow the prompts, my last install took less then 10 min. including configuration. Admin is via a nice web interface (green zone accessable only) as are updates after installation. The current version 1.3 is based on the 2.4.x kernal and uses iptables.
